Kind of fascinating to watch this as a lawyer myself. There's just such fundamental misunderstanding of what the court system is and how it works.

Imagine a chemical manufacturing plant. It's not designed to take in just any old feed stock. It can only do a limited number of things for obvious reasons. As you try and broaden the scope of what can be input and still get your product, your plant becomes so large, so expensive, and so complex that it's simply not viable to operate.

Courts are the same way. They're not Soloman or Judge Judy just letting anyone come in to bicker in front of them. They are designed to handle specific types of issues/ideas in conflict, framed in specific ways to be amenable to processing. Just like the chemical plant described above takes only certain feedstocks. That's why lawyers spend so much time in school. They have to be experts in what types of issues/ideas can be meaningfully presented to a court. Same as the engineers in that chemical processing plant are experts in what their process can actually do.
